As the story goes ... Once upon a time, there was a rich trader who lived in a huge house who had a poor neighbour living in a tiny house just behind the rich trader's kitchen. For every of holy days or when the trader threw a banquet the rich scents and odour of the kitchen would permeate into the poor neighbour's living room cum kitchen cum pantry cum occasional guest bedroom. Despite all the rich food, the trader felt lethargic and frail and never had a good day. Once in a blue moon she had the chance to meet her poor neighbour. Actually, it was the converse - the poor neighbour might chance upon meeting the trader. For this particular blue moon, the trader was especially irritated and so when she saw the happy and healthy countenance of her poor neighbour she became extremely annoyed. "What reason for thy fumbling and demeaning expressing of joy and unbounded appearance of health? What measure of food my servants might have smuggled thee and which case I would consider theft?" "Nay. Surely not." Said the poor neighbour. "For it is thine own generosity from which did I benefit." "Excellent. What then shalt thou consider as recompense for this benefit which thou hast unreasonably taken from me without my prior adjudging or deliberation?" "I have not any means to pay thee nor any meaning to pay for scents and odour that waft into my abode without my prior consideration or deliberation." "Nay so, for if my pet cat or dog wafted into thine household without thy prior consideration or deliberation, shouldest thou not return them each in one piece and alive rather than consume them for thy personal culinary and nutritional benefit? So return me my scents and odours." She demanded. "Nay too, as if it came to that situation, I would have none of any resources to recapture thy pets unless thou provided the man-, woman- or person-power to capture the pets for thyself and recompense me for the trespass of thy wafty entities as well as the trespass of those whom thou wouldest send to recapture thy privacy." Years passed with many friends and relatives as well as unsolicited strangers wafting into the poor neighbour's house to enjoy the rich waft of the rich trader's kichen. So it came to pass that the neighbours chanced upon another blue moon. "Thou has yet to recapture my assets that had wafted into thine household. But I shall forgive and forget and hold you no more responsible for their recapture. But I understand not why thee and thy many friends exude such countenance of health and happiness. For I have had for many years no more feasts nor festivities from which thou nor thy equally poor friends could benefit." "You forget we have memory. For the good scents and odours have been archived in our memory and whenever we think about them we become unboundlessly joyous and happy." "I entreat thee to erase such memory from thy archive for it is my privacy that thou art accessing each time you recall those scents and odours. That is the least thou shouldest have done for me." "What about the scents archived in the memories of my myriad of friends and relatives? Even if I could erase my memory off thy privacy but I retain no means nor such authority to erase thy supposed assets off my friends and relatives." On hearing that, the rich trader walked away, feeling more and more discouraged about the loss of her privacy that had leaked into her neighbourhood.
